Puerarin (4’,7-dihydroxy-8-β-D-glucosylisoflavone), a C-glycoside, is present in large amount as the active component of Pueraria lobata (Wild.) Ohwi, a commonly used Chinese herbal medicine. Large numbers of studies show that puerarin may prevent cancer, act as an antioxidant, scavenge free radicals, lower serum cholesterol and have antithrombotic and antiallergic activities.However, widely clinical utilizations of puerarin have been suffering from its poor fat-solubility and water-solubility, low bioavailability and obvious side effects of injection for a long time (>10 days). Previous studies indicated that a low affinity between cell and glucose connecting to puerarin led to little absorption. In the present study, in order to modify these properties of puerarin mentioned above, a novel puerarin derivative (4’, 7-dihydroxy-8-β-D-tetraacetyl-glucosylisoflavone,4ac) was synthesized by acetylation. In comparison to puerarin,4ac was more fat-soluble and its bioavailability was improved. Furthermore, our pharmacological test demonstrated 4ac was effective on treating arrhythmia induced by chloroform, myocardial ischemia induced by hypophysin and hyperlipemia in rats. Hence,4ac has the potential to be developed into a new drug.According to its physico-chemical properties and clinical requirement, injection based on freeze-dried powder was chosen, and optimum processing conditions were established by screening of different preparative conditions and orthogonal design experiment.Results of differential scanning calorimeters (DSC), infrared (IR), scanning electron microscopy (SEM) etc showed that obvious interaction was not detected between 4ac and other compositions. The freeze-dry powder of 4ac was a solid dispersion and not a new compound, which implied that the preparative process was successful. The establishment of quality control standard, stability study and pharmacology study has provided further theoretical and practical support to the safety and efficacy of 4ac in freeze-dried powder form.
